Last updated: May 2026
Cookie Notice - Webstore
SOHAM INC. and its group entities d/b/a Zenoti (“Zenoti”) is committed to protecting your privacy.
Throughout this notice, the terms “we”, “us”, “our” or “ours” refer to Zenoti. And the terms “you”, “your” or “yours” refer to you (as the Data Subject). Subscriber refers to any customer or business that uses or subscribes to any Zenoti software or services, including but not limited to Subscriber’s employees, advisors, contractors, agents, consultants, or others acting on behalf of the Subscriber. Guest refers to our Subscriber’s customer.
Cookies are small files that are stored on a user's computer. They are designed to hold a modest amount of data specific to a particular client and website and can be accessed either by the web server or the client computer. This allows the server to deliver a page tailored to a particular user.
This Cookie Notice explains how Zenoti uses cookies and/or other tracking mechanisms on our webstore.
When subscribers/merchants use our platform to power their online stores, we place the following cookies for visitors of their stores:
Necessary cookies
Necessary cookies are crucial for the basic functions of the website, and the website will not work in its intended way without them.
| Cookie provider | Cookie name | Expiry | Purpose |
|---|---|---|---|
| Zenoti | Zenoti_Browser_Context | 10 years | Generates a unique browser identifier to recognize returning visitors and maintain a consistent webstore experience. |
| Zenoti | MMSRequestContext | Session | Maintains your active webstore session so the server can preserve your booking and business-location context during your visit. |
| Zenoti | MMSContext | Session | Stores supporting session information used together with MMSRequestContext to identify your current webstore session on the server. |
| Zenoti | last_seen | Session | Records the time of your most recent interaction to manage session timeouts and maintain security. |
| Zenoti | LastAccessedTime | Session | Records the timestamp of your most recent activity so the webstore can detect idle sessions and refresh them when needed. |
| _GRECAPTCHA | 6 months | Used by Google reCAPTCHA to distinguish legitimate users from automated activity and protect webstore forms from spam and abuse. | |
| Zenoti | paymenturlloadedtime | 1 day | Records when the payment page was loaded so the webstore can detect stale or expired payment sessions before a transaction is submitted. |
| Zenoti | w_authInfo | 1 day | Maintains your sign-in state on the legacy webstore so you remain logged in while navigating between pages during the same day. |
| Zenoti | googleUserId | 1 day | Stores the identifier returned by Google when you choose “Sign in with Google” to complete the sign-in process. |
| Zenoti | _rwg_token | 30 days | Stores a Reserve-with-Google attribution token when you arrive from a Google booking link so the booking can be credited to the originating Google listing. |
| Zenoti | globalLanguagePreferences_{{accountname}} | 365 days | Stores your language and regional preferences so the webstore can display content in your preferred language and format. |
Local storage
Each local storage item is prefixed with the <Client_Id>, which is the name of the client that is mapped in Zenoti.
| Cookie provider | Cookie name | Expiry | Purpose |
|---|---|---|---|
| Zenoti | <Client_Id>_payment_redirect | Persistent | Remembers the page to return you to after a successful payment when redirected back from a payment provider. |
| Zenoti | <Client_Id>_previous_route | Persistent | Remembers the screen you navigated from so the webstore can return you there after sign-in or profile updates. |
| Zenoti | <Client_Id>_ClickOnBookNowTimeStamp | Persistent | Helps prevent accidental duplicate bookings caused by repeated clicks during the booking process. |
| Zenoti | <Client_Id>_from_GC_Checkout | Persistent | Indicates that you are in the gift card purchase flow so the webstore can direct you to the correct confirmation screen after payment. |
| Zenoti | <Client_Id>_is_processing_payment | Persistent | Tracks whether a payment is in progress when payment providers redirect you away from and back to the webstore. |
| Zenoti | <Client_Id>_processing_payment_invoiceId | Persistent | Stores the invoice ID for the in-progress transaction so the correct order can be resumed after a payment-gateway redirect. |
| Zenoti | <Client_Id>_urlParams | Persistent | Preserves URL parameters across payment-gateway redirects to maintain transaction and navigation context. |
| Zenoti | <Client_Id>_confirmBookingParams | Persistent | Stores booking confirmation details across payment-gateway redirects so your appointment can be finalized when you return. |
| Zenoti | <Client_Id>_reservationId | Persistent | Stores the reservation ID for your in-progress appointment so it can be matched and confirmed after a payment-gateway redirect. |
| Zenoti | <Client_Id>_selectedDeals | Persistent | Stores selected deals so they remain available and can be applied after returning from a payment-gateway redirect. |
| Zenoti | <Client_Id>_sales_id | Persistent | Stores the membership or package ID being purchased so the correct item can be finalized after a payment-gateway redirect. |
| Zenoti | <Client_Id>_smartUrl | Persistent | Remembers the original URL visited, including deep-link parameters, so the webstore can return you to the correct page after sign-in. |
| Zenoti | <Client_Id>_sessionId | Persistent | Stores your webstore session ID so the server can recognize subsequent requests without requiring repeated authentication. |
| Zenoti | <Client_Id>_fullName | Persistent | Stores your full name locally after sign-in so the webstore can greet you and pre-fill forms during your visit. |
| Zenoti | <Client_Id>_userId | Persistent | Stores your unique guest ID after sign-in so the webstore can retrieve your bookings, memberships, and other personalized information. |
| Zenoti | <Client_Id>_guestemail | Persistent | Stores the email address used during sign-in so it can be pre-filled in forms and confirmations during your visit. |
| Zenoti | <Client_Id>_accessToken | Persistent | Stores the authentication token required to maintain a secure signed-in session during your visit. |
| Zenoti | <Client_Id>_loginType | Persistent | Records the sign-in method used so the webstore can manage sign-out and re-authentication correctly. |
Analytics cookies
Analytical cookies are used to understand how visitors interact with the website. These cookies help provide information on metrics the number of visitors, bounce rate, traffic source, etc.
| Cookie provider | Cookie name | Expiry | Purpose |
|---|---|---|---|
| Google Analytics | _ga | 2 years | Used by Google Analytics to recognize returning visitors and group activity into sessions for website traffic and marketing performance analysis. |
| Google Analytics | _gid | 1 day | Used by Google Analytics to identify browsers for daily visit counts and aggregated pageview reporting. |
| Google Analytics | _gat_UA-19834493-2 | 1 minute | Used by Google Analytics to manage the rate of data collection during periods of high traffic. Does not store personal information. |
Marketing Analytics cookies
These cookies are used to measure website usage and marketing performance, including tracking conversions from advertising campaigns and enabling retargeting and analytics to improve marketing effectiveness.
| Cookie provider | Cookie name | Expiry | Purpose |
|---|---|---|---|
| Google Tag Manager | _gcl_au | 3 months | Present only when Google Ads conversion tracking is enabled via the center's Google Tag Manager setup. It stores a click identifier from Google Ads, allowing webstore purchases and bookings to be linked back to the ad click that drove them for reporting purposes. |
| _fbp | 3 months | Present only when a Facebook Pixel ID is configured in the center's webstore settings (such as facebook_pixel_id, centerFBPixelId, or an organization-level Pixel). It identifies the browser to Meta so that webstore conversions, including bookings, memberships, and gift card purchases, can be tied back to Meta ad campaigns, support retargeting and lookalike audience creation, and serve as a signal for ad delivery optimization. |
Zenoti Webstore supports integration with cookie consent management tools that allow visitors to manage their cookie preferences. Depending on the configuration implemented by the Subscriber/Merchant, visitors may be able to grant, refuse, or withdraw consent for non-essential cookies through the cookie consent banner/settings option available on the Webstore.
Most web browsers also allow users to manage or delete cookies through browser settings.
You can find our Privacy Notice at https://www.zenoti.com/privacy-notice
If you have any questions regarding this cookie notice, you may contact us at privacy@zenoti.com






